Loop detection commands

MDC is supported only when the device operates in standalone mode. For more information about standalone mode, see IRF configuration in Virtual Technologies Configuration Guide. For more information about MDC and device models that support MDC, see MDC configuration in Virtual Technologies Configuration Guide.

display loopback-detection

Use display loopback-detection to display the loop detection configuration and status.

Syntax

display loopback-detection [ loop-info ]

Views

Any view

Predefined user roles

network-admin

network-operator

mdc-admin

mdc-operator

Parameters

loop-info: Displays only information about ports where loops have been detected. If you do not specify this keyword, the command will also display information about the ports shut down by loop detection. A port shut down by loop detection stays in looped state until it comes up.

Example

# Display the loop detection configuration and status.

<Sysname> display loopback-detection

Loop detection is enabled.

Global loop detection interval is 30 second(s).

Loop is detected on following interfaces:

  Interface                      Action mode     VLANs/VSI

  Ten-GigabitEthernet1/0/2       Shutdown        5

  Ten-GigabitEthernet3/0/3       None            10

# Display only information about ports where loops have been detected.

<Sysname> display loopback-detection loop-info

Loop detection is enabled.

Global loop detection interval is 30 second(s).

Loop is detected on following interfaces:

  Interface                      Action mode     VLANs/VSI

  Ten-GigabitEthernet1/0/3       None            10

  Ten-GigabitEthernet1/0/4       VLAN-block      20

Table 1 Command output

Field

Description

Action mode

Loop protection action:

·     Block—When a loop is detected on an interface, the device performs the following operations:

¡     Generates a log.

¡     Disables the interface from learning MAC addresses.

¡     Blocks the interface.

·     None—When a loop is detected on an interface, the device generates a log but performs no action on the interface.

·     No-learning—When a loop is detected on an interface, the device generates a log and disables the interface from learning MAC addresses.

·     Shutdown—When a loop is detected on an interface, the device performs the following operations:

¡     Generates a log.

¡     Shuts down the interface to disable the interface from receiving or sending frames. The device automatically sets the interface to the forwarding state after a time interval. Set the time interval by using the shutdown-interval command (see Fundamentals Command Reference).

·     VLAN-block—When a loop is detected in a protected VLAN on an interface, the device generates a log and blocks the traffic from the protected VLAN on all interfaces configured with this action.

VLANs/VSI

VLANs or VSI to which the interface belongs and where loops are detected.

loopback-detection action

Use loopback-detection action to set the loop protection action on an interface.

Use undo loopback-detection action to restore the default.

Syntax

loopback-detection action { block | no-learning | shutdown | vlan-block }

undo loopback-detection action

Default

When the device detects a loop on an interface, it generates a log but performs no action on the interface.

Views

Layer 2 Ethernet interface view

Layer 2 aggregate interface view

Predefined user roles

network-admin

mdc-admin

Parameters

block: Enables the block mode. If a loop is detected, the device performs the following operations:

·     Generates a log.

·     Disables MAC address learning.

·     Blocks the interface.

no-learning: Enables the no-learning mode. If a loop is detected, the device generates a log and disables MAC address learning on the interface. Layer 2 aggregate interfaces do not support this keyword.

shutdown: Enables the shutdown mode. If a loop is detected, the device generates a log and shuts down the interface. The device automatically sets the interface to the forwarding state after the time interval set by using the shutdown-interval command (see Fundamentals Command Reference).

vlan-block: Enables the VLAN-block mode. If a loop is detected in a protected VLAN on an interface, the device generates a log and blocks traffic from the protected VLAN on all interfaces in this mode.

Usage guidelines

To set the loop protection action globally, use the loopback-detection global action command.

The global action applies to all interfaces. An interface-specific action applies only to the interface on which the action is configured. On an interface, the interface-specific action takes precedence over the global action.

On an interface, the VLAN-block mode is mutually exclusive with spanning tree, RRPP, ERPS, and Smart Link.

Example

# Set the loop protection action to shutdown on Ten-GigabitEthernet 3/0/1.

<Sysname> system-view

[Sysname] interface ten-gigabitethernet 3/0/1

[System-Ten-GigabitEthernet3/0/1] loopback-detection action shutdown

Related commands

display loopback-detection

loopback-detection global action

loopback-detection delay-timer

Use loopback-detection delay-timer to set the loop protection delay timer on an interface.

Use undo loopback-detection delay-timer to disable loop protection delay on an interface.

Syntax

loopback-detection delay-timer time

undo loopback-detection delay-timer

Default

Loop protection delay is disabled on an interface.

Views

Layer 2 Ethernet interface view

Layer 2 aggregate interface view

Predefined user roles

network-admin

mdc-admin

Parameters

time: Sets the loop protection delay timer, in seconds. The value range for this argument is 1 to 1000.

Usage guidelines

On a network protected by loop detection, the shutdown or block action taken on a looped interface of an upstream device might cause traffic interruption to its downstream devices. To minimize the impacts of loop detection on downstream traffic, set the loop protection delay timer on upstream devices. This delay allows the downstream devices to remove loops before the upstream devices take an action.

The global delay timer applies to all interfaces enabled with loop detection. An interface-specific delay timer applies only to the interface on which it is configured. On an interface, the interface-specific delay timer takes precedence over the global delay timer.

Example

# Set the loop protection delay timer to 100 seconds on Ten-GigabitEthernet 3/0/1.

<Sysname> system-view

[Sysname] interface ten-gigabitethernet 3/0/1

[System-Ten-GigabitEthernet3/0/1] loopback-detection delay-timer 100

Related commands

loopback-detection global delay-timer

loopback-detection enable

Use loopback-detection enable to enable loop detection on an interface.

Use undo loopback-detection enable to disable loop detection on an interface.

Syntax

loopback-detection enable vlan { vlan-id-list | all }

undo loopback-detection enable vlan { vlan-id-list | all }

Default

Loop detection is disabled on interfaces.

Views

Layer 2 Ethernet interface view

Layer 2 aggregate interface view

Predefined user roles

network-admin

mdc-admin

Parameters

vlan-id-list: Specifies a space-separated list of up to 10 VLAN items. Each item specifies a VLAN ID or a range of VLAN IDs in the form of vlan-id1 to vlan-id2. The value range for VLAN IDs is 1 to 4094. The ID for vlan-id2 must be no less than the ID for vlan-id1.

all: Specifies all existing VLANs.

Usage guidelines

You can enable loop detection globally or on a per-interface basis. When an interface receives a detection frame in any VLAN, the loop protection action is triggered on that interface, regardless of whether loop detection is enabled on it.

Example

# Enable loop detection on Ten-GigabitEthernet 3/0/1 for VLAN 10 through VLAN 20.

<Sysname> system-view

[Sysname] interface ten-gigabitethernet 3/0/1

[System-Ten-GigabitEthernet3/0/1] loopback-detection enable vlan 10 to 20

Related commands

display loopback-detection

loopback-detection global enable

loopback-detection global action

Use loopback-detection global action to set the global loop protection action.

Use undo loopback-detection global action to restore the default.

Syntax

loopback-detection global action shutdown

undo loopback-detection global action

Default

When the device detects a loop on an interface, it generates a log but performs no action on the interface.

Views

System view

Predefined user roles

network-admin

mdc-admin

Parameters

shutdown: Enables the shutdown mode. If a loop is detected, the device generates a log and shuts down the interface. The device automatically sets the interface to the forwarding state after you set the time interval by using the shutdown-interval command (see Fundamentals Command Reference).

Usage guidelines

To set the loop protection action on a per-interface basis, use the loopback-detection action command in interface view.

The global action applies to all interfaces. An interface-specific action applies only to the interface on which it is configured. On an interface, the interface-specific action takes precedence over the global action.

Example

# Set the global loop protection action to shutdown.

<Sysname> system-view

[System] loopback-detection global action shutdown

Related commands

display loopback-detection

loopback-detection action

loopback-detection delay-timer

Use loopback-detection delay-timer to set the global loop protection delay timer.

Use undo loopback-detection delay-timer to disable loop protection delay globally.

Syntax

loopback-detection delay-timer time

undo loopback-detection delay-timer

Default

Loop protection delay is disabled on globally.

Views

System view

Predefined user roles

network-admin

mdc-admin

Parameters

time: Sets the loop protection delay timer, in seconds. The value range for this argument is 1 to 1000.

Usage guidelines

On a network protected by loop detection, the shutdown or block action taken on a looped interface of an upstream device might cause traffic interruption to its downstream devices. To minimize the impacts of loop detection on downstream traffic, set the loop protection delay timer on upstream devices. This delay allows the downstream devices to remove loops before the upstream devices take an action.

The global delay timer applies to all interfaces enabled with loop detection. An interface-specific delay timer applies only to the interface on which it is configured. On an interface, the interface-specific delay timer takes precedence over the global delay timer.

Example

# Set the global loop protection delay timer to 100 seconds.

<Sysname> system-view

[Sysname] loopback-detection global delay-timer 100

Related commands

loopback-detection delay-timer

loopback-detection global enable

Use loopback-detection global enable to enable loop detection globally.

Use undo loopback-detection global enable to disable loop detection globally.

Syntax

loopback-detection global enable vlan { vlan-id-list | all }

undo loopback-detection global enable vlan { vlan-id-list | all }

Default

Loop detection is globally disabled.

Views

System view

Predefined user roles

network-admin

mdc-admin

Parameters

vlan-id-list: Specifies a space-separated list of up to 10 VLAN items. Each item specifies a VLAN ID or a range of VLAN IDs in the form of vlan-id1 to vlan-id2. The value range for VLAN IDs is 1 to 4094. The ID for vlan-id2 must be equal to or greater than the ID for vlan-id1.

all: Specifies all existing VLANs.

Usage guidelines

You can enable loop detection globally or on a per-interface basis. When an interface receives a detection frame in any VLAN, the loop protection action is triggered on that interface, regardless of whether loop detection is enabled on it.

Example

# Globally enable loop detection for VLAN 10 through VLAN 20.

<Sysname> system-view

[System] loopback-detection global enable vlan 10 to 20

Related commands

display loopback-detection

loopback-detection enable

loopback-detection interval-time

Use loopback-detection interval-time to set the loop detection interval.

Use undo loopback-detection interval-time to restore the default.

Syntax

loopback-detection interval-time interval

undo loopback-detection interval-time

Default

The loop detection interval is 30 seconds.

Views

System view

Predefined user roles

network-admin

mdc-admin

Parameters

interval: Sets the loop detection interval in the range of 1 to 300 seconds.

Usage guidelines

With loop detection enabled, the device sends loop detection frames at the specified interval. A shorter interval offers more sensitive detection but consumes more resources. Consider the system performance and loop detection speed when you set the loop detection interval.

Example

# Set the loop detection interval to 10 seconds.

<Sysname> system-view

[Sysname] loopback-detection interval-time 10

Related commands

display loopback-detection

loopback-detection protected-vlan

Use loopback-detection protected-vlan to configure protected VLANs.

Use undo loopback-detection protected-vlan to delete protected VLANs.

Views

loopback-detection protected-vlan vlan-id-list

undo loopback-detection protected-vlan vlan-id-list

Default

No protected VLANs are configured for loop detection.

Views

System view

Predefined user roles

network-admin

mdc-admin

Parameters

vlan-id-list: Specifies a space-separated list of up to 10 VLAN items. Each item specifies a VLAN ID or a range of VLAN IDs in the format of vlan-id1 to vlan-id2. The end VLAN ID must be greater than the start VLAN ID. The value range for VLAN IDs is 1 to 4094.

Usage guidelines

The loopback-detection protected-vlan, instance, and stp vlan enable commands are mutually exclusive with one another. For more information about the instance and stp vlan enable commands, see "Spanning tree commands."

After you configure protected VLANs, you cannot change the spanning tree mode between PVST and any other mode.

Example

# Configure VLAN 100 as a protected VLAN.

<Sysname> system-view

[Sysname] loopback-detection protected-vlan 100

Related commands

instance

loopback-detection action

stp mode

stp vlan enable
